Re: Apple II <-> Commodore 64/128 disks?



William McBrine <wmcbrine@clark.net> wrote:
 >the Apple II FAQ states that apple disks are incompatible
 >with IBM PC drives, and vice versa
 
Oh?
 
At KansasFest, with the whole world watching, I popped a blank 3.5"
HD disk into a SuperDrive attached to a IIGS, and while still in the
Finder, formatted it for MS-DOS. I then copied some files from my
Focus hard drive to the MS-DOS formatted disk...all without ever
leaving the Finder.
 
Unfortunately (or, fortunately - depending on your perspective) no
one at Kfest had a Wintel machine, but had there been one there, I
would have then popped the disk into the Wintel machine, and it would
have been recognized as an MS-DOS formatted disk.
 
Any Apple IIGS owner might be able to perform that same magic trick
this week or next; it all depends on what the beta test team says.
